tHeINFamoUS Posted February 21, 2019 Report Share Posted February 21, 2019 I'm a fan of the crankdown. Aside from the WNC I like my hoggs, 316 crankdown hyper herring and bullshad 4x4 (thats a real sleeper bait). I have mixed experiences with the RM Lipped Trick and DRT Tiny Klash. Had two tricks, great baits, subtle swim on a steady retrieve, good on a stop and go retrieve and could get em to dance real well with some handle work. Problem was durability, they both had tails that fell out and needed replacing (RMUSA sent me a couple) and one lost its lip, that and the ease in which they rash but thats inherent in most wood baits. The TK....lip fell out working it off of rock structure first time I fished it, took forever to find a replacement lip, will probably never buy another drt bait. Sounds like you got a pair of good baits already, I'd just fish those before buying others. WNC is a real versatile bait.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
